Support for the research enterprise

On Wednesday, Nov. 16, the Honourable François-Philippe Champagne, Minister of Innovation, Science and Industry to support the Canadian research landscape. The announcement was made during the Minister카지노 게임 컬렉션s live remarks at the (CSPC 2022) and reflects fulfillment of commitments from Budget 2022.

카지노 게임 컬렉션Canadian research helps improve our society, economy and healthcare, time and time again. That카지노 게임 컬렉션s why our government remains committed to supporting the country카지노 게임 컬렉션s world-class research community카지노 게임 컬렉션, says Minister Champagne. 카지노 게임 컬렉션We know the vital role research and science play in growing our economy, and today카지노 게임 컬렉션s investments will help Canada cement its position as a world leader in research and innovation.카지노 게임 컬렉션

One of the grant results announced was the (RSF), which helps institutions 카지노 게임 컬렉션enhance their safety and security procedures, hire adequate administrative support for various tasks, and advance projects that prioritize innovation as well as equity, diversity and inclusion카지노 게임 컬렉션. The fund also supports the creation of online research databases, and maintaining research structures in unique and remote areas. The federal government has committed to a $7,918,571 investment to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s research via the RSF, plus $1,253,840 through the Incremental Project Grants.

As a result of the funded by the Social Sciences and Humanities Research Council (SSHRC), 13 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s researchers were granted over 770k to advance research in topics like childcare equity, gender gaps in the labour market, resilience in family caregivers, sustainable economy, and indigenous weather forecasting. This funding provides support for research in its initial stages, including those based on new research questions, methods, theoretical approaches and/or ideas.

Key relationships with key stakeholders

The relationship between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s and government partners was also strengthened by two visits during this week.

On Monday, Nov. 14, Minister Champagne visited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s to speak with students and meet with senior leadership and members of the research community who are advancing life-saving research and clean energy to build a stronger and more resilient Canada.

On Tuesday, Nov. 15, SSHRC카지노 게임 컬렉션s president Ted Hewitt were also welcomed on campus. He and his team met with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s senior leadership and early career researchers. 카지노 게임 컬렉션It was a great pleasure to be able to spend time at Queen's and to learn firsthand about the exciting work Queen's faculty and students are undertaking.  As always, SSHRC stands ready to support these ground-breaking initiatives now and well into the future," said Hewitt. The visit schedule included meetings with scholars in Indigenous and Black Studies research.

카지노 게임 컬렉션Between visits from Minister Champagne and Ted Hewitt, and new funding for our social sciences and humanities scholars, this has been an incredibly exciting week for research at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s,카지노 게임 컬렉션 says Nancy Ross, Vice-Principal Research. 카지노 게임 컬렉션These engagements remind us of the critical importance of working in partnership with government to support research that is pushing the boundaries of knowledge and tackling the world카지노 게임 컬렉션s greatest challenges.카지노 게임 컬렉션

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s discusses science policy

As part of CSPC 2022, on Thursday, Nov. 17,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s will host a panel of academics and industry representatives to discuss critical technologies and essential policies to better support Canada's low-carbon economy. Speakers include Warren Mabee (Queen카지노 게임 컬렉션s School of Policy Studies), representatives from Kiwetinohk Energy Corp., Anna Harrison (French National Scientific Research Centre), Joule Bergerson (카지노게임사이트 of Calgary).

Panelists are expected to address issues like how to best reduce sectoral emissions related to Canada's existing energy sector, effective technologies to capture and reutilize carbon, and tools to drive behavioural change.
